Great location, bad rooms

2.0 of 5 bubblesReviewed 24 Aug 2011
This is a great area for a vacation but the rooms are nasty. This could be a nice place but they need better cleaning and maitenance. Need to invest a little money in the rooms. Loved the beach and the rooms are right by the lake. Sandy beach, clean sandy-bottom lake, play area for kids, bonfire areas, jetskis for rent. Spiderwebs all over doorway on arrival, spiders all over inside,fridge from the 70's that was barely cold and dripped water inside, faucet wouldn't shut off, mouse droppings found in room, mousetraps under beds. If you're not very picky it's pretty affordable. We are planning to go back but stay somewhere else next time.

Reviewed 19 July 2010

When we got to the motel, we were asked for cash up front "to guarantee the rate". We gave them cash for two nights. The room we were given had obviously been used and left unclean--sand in the tub, almost no toilet paper, not enough towels for two people, no light bulbs in the bedside light, sand residue on the tv console area. The young woman from the office was pleasant at first, but balked when we decided to move on the next day and wanted our money back. "I couldn't rent the room to others, so you should pay as agreed." I pointed out that we were virtually the only guests, so she could hardly use that as an excuse. Too bad--the beach frontage was a potential real plus, but the service/cleanliness was so poor that I'd advise others to choose one of the MANY other choices of lodging in the area.

Reviewed 12 September 2008

We had previously stayed at the Aurora Beach Resort and Motel and had one of the worst experiences of our lives as far as travel goes. It was not the location because that is great as it sits on 300 feet or so of pure sandy beach. We loved that, it was the management that walked around drunk and belligerent. The management consisted of about 4 or 5 adults that were all in various states of inebriation and could not be less professional. The rooms were not clean and the place was a dump. This year as we were heading to Oscoda to spend our vacation we went by the Aurora on our way to another place to stay but noticed that the lawn was nice and the flowers were pretty...the place just looked a lot better! We bit. So I went in to inquire and met a wonderful couple named Lauri and Rob that were probably the most hospitable people I have ever met. The prices were cheap and the rooms that we got (4) were impeccably cleaned. These rooms are not new by any means, but they were clean and smelled fresh. They were welcoming to say the least. I was VERY impressed at the change that took place in the management and frankly would not have thought it possible in only a year. The resort is very family friendly, very inexpensive, and very clean. There is little that Rob or Lauri would not do to assure us of a good time. We had a great time and will be back again next year. They even added Wi-Fi which my son loved! They havebig play structures for the kids and beach volleyball and fire pits with plenty of fire wood for everyone to use (for free!). I liked not having to bring my own grill too!
On the last day there Lauri had my Daughter (3 year old) over to their place (the managers live onsight) and her little boy and my daughter watched a couple movies and had strawberry shortcake. That was a nice gesture and we really appreciated that Lauri!
